Urgent: Help Flood-Hit Families in Maharashtra Rebuild Their Lives
Project
In September, heavy rains triggered devastating floods across Nashik, Solapur, Beed, Dharashiv, and Marathwada. Rivers overflowed, villages were submerged, and thousands of families were forced to flee their homes overnight.
“We ran out with only the clothes on our back. The water rose so fast, we couldn’t save anything,” says Meena, a mother of three from Nashik.
Current Situation
Thousands of homes have collapsed or been damaged beyond repair.
Over 3.8 lakh hectares of crops have been destroyed, leaving lakhs of farmers with no harvest and no income.
More than 31.6 lakh farmers have lost lands and livelihoods
Livestock have perished or gone missing, and fodder for surviving animals has run out.
Families Struggling to Survive
Homes have been reduced to rubble, belongings washed away, and entire communities remain cut off. Relief camps are overwhelmed, clean water is scarce, and families who once lived with dignity are now dependent on aid for survival.
“My children ask me when we can go back home, but there is no home left. All we have is this shelter and hope that someone will help us,” says Ramesh, a flood survivor from Beed.
The Farmer’s Pain
For farming families, the floods are even more devastating. Soyabean, cotton, maize, tur dal, and sugarcane fields are gone just weeks before harvest.
“Our fields are underwater today, but our debts are not. We don’t know how we’ll survive the next season,” shares Ganesh, a farmer from Dharashiv.
Without crops or cattle, farmers have lost not only their present income but also their future. The fear of hunger and mounting debt overshadows every household.

FAQs
After you complete your donation successfully, you will find the 'GET 80G' button on the payment success page. Please fill in your PAN number, complete address, and name as per PAN and submit. Your 80G certificate will be generated and sent via email within 24 hours.
Alternatively, you can get your 80G receipt in a few simple steps:
- Log in to your account using the same email ID you used for the donation
- Go to ‘My Donations’
- Choose the financial year for which you'd like the donation certificate
- Click on ‘Download 80G Certificate’
- Fill out the Form (if required)
- Submit the form and 80G will get downloaded instantly
Instead of receiving separate 80G certificates for each donation, you'll receive a consolidated 80G certificate via email covering all your donations made through our platform in the financial year. Further, The corresponding 10BE form that proves your eligibility for the tax deduction will also be consolidated. This way, you won't have to worry about multiple downloads and can save time.
To qualify for tax exemption on your donations, you need to obtain a 10BE. This can be done by filing your 80G claims for donations made during the Financial Year (FY). You can download your 10BE from the‘My Profile’ section by 31st May of the next FY and also receive it via email.
For example: if you made donations between April 2023 and March 2024 (FY 2023-24), you will get your 10BE by 31st May 2024, provided you need to claim the 80G for these donations.
Please note that you cannot claim 80G for donations made between April 2022 and March 2023 (FY 2022-23) anymore as the window for claiming it has closed. However, you can still get the 10BEs for that year if you made 80G claims on or before 31st July 2023.
